Are you Familiar with the Term: Search Engine?

What does it mean?
The search engine stores information about a large number of web pages and people use it for faster surfing on the Internet. A search engine is designed to find information by retrieving the stored data that matches the one in which the user is interested in. Web crawlers are used to organize the web wide words creating a copy of all visited pages to be processed by a search engine that will index them, making the search faster. Site pages are indexed depending on certain criteria like area of interest, keywords, information novelty. However sometimes non-relevant pages are found and people have to search deeper in order to find what they want.

How does a search engine work?
The search engine doesn’t rely on past experience or ask questions to ease your search like a librarian does. If you need to find something about “health” for example, it will find pages that have the word “health” in the titles, in the first paragraphs and in its content. The frequency of the keyword on a site is very important. A higher frequency will keep the site in top or offer it a certain position depending on the competition’s sites as well. However, some sites, that exaggerate the number of keywords repeating them too much, are penalized for spamming.

Search engine optimization
Everyone wants to be in the top ten because the higher you are in position, the more money you make. Using detailed information about search engine optimization will improve your ranking and, most importantly, your displayed position. Search engine optimization actually means designing your site to make it more appealing for the web crawlers. From millions of sites, about ten of them get to be displayed on the first page. Therefore, every webmaster’s goal is to have their site listed among the first ones in a search engine. This is how they increase the number of people accessing their pages.

The first thing to have in mind is to use target keywords. This is very important because people search info using target words. The better optimized on some keywords your site is, the faster it will be displayed on the first page. For example, if you have a site about “traveling to Italy”, then your keywords will be “Italy traveling”. Your keywords should contain 2 or more words because one word will be to general and you risk being eliminated from the first 10 sites. There are a lot of search engine web sites and each has a different ranking algorithm. A site can have a different positioning depending on the search engine the user is looking with. Keep this in mind, it really doesn’t matter which search engine you use, just search using relevant keywords and you can get your results faster and more accurately.

The position of your keywords is also very important. Using keywords in the title tag and giving it an attractive look is essential and will get you a higher ranking on the search engine. Making the titles short is another good idea. No one likes long boring titles. Also use the keywords in the headlines because any search engine will tend to raise pages that have the keyword on top. You should also have a relevant content. Your keywords should match the topic and it is preferable to use HTLM whenever possible because this will not only impress the visitors, but will also put you on the top of the page. HTLM links are a must. Avoid using frames because frame links can not be followed and this will decrease your ranking in the search engine display. Also don’t forget to expand your text! For example “Italy traveling” may include “travelers” or “traveling tips” or any other related words.

Link building is not to be neglected. Any search engine uses link analysis to rank sites. They usually do this because webmasters tend to fake good links and try to spam the search engine. It is important to study your competitors keywords, use alternative text and insure that pages are accessible through regular links (avoid using Java, JavaScript or Macromedia flash). Spamming and the use of deceiving techniques may get your site banned or penalized by the search engine web sites. Spam mail has to be avoided too because this degrades the value of the search engine listing and you end up cheating on yourself.

Submit your sites to search engines by using two or three pages that summarize your web site content and also try to avoid the aid of submitting programs. This method helps you see when a problem occurs. Sometimes it lasts up to a month or two before your submitted pages appear listed. Some search engine sites may not even accept to list every page so patience is needed. After your pages get listed, you have to monitor the listing every week because errors may occur and your efforts have to be directed in the right way. Knowing your situation in the search engine will help decide which improvements have to be made and what investments are necessary.
